WebThe song proved so popular with audiences that Flatt and Scruggs hired a new bassist, Joe Stuart, to allow Graves to play resonator guitar full-time. Many country and bluegrass enthusiasts credit the Dobro for reinvigorating Flatt and Scruggs ' sound, and Graves remained a member of the Foggy Mountain Boys until the band splintered in 1969.

WebA pivotal member of the hugely successful bluegrass band Flatt and Scruggs and the Foggy Mountain Boys, Dobro pioneer Josh Graves (1927-2006) was a living link between bluegrass music and the blues. Josh Graves’ solo on “John Henry” on the Flatt and Scruggs’ Foggy Mountain Banjo album is a must-learn solo for bluegrass dobroists. Not only is it a great tune to play, but it includes some classic licks that most of the great modern dobro players have stolen and adapted for their own uses.
